PEPS
Locations: 4649 Sunnyside Ave N Seattle, Washington, US + (+1 more)
Company Size: 1 - 100
Industry: Individual and Family Services
Locations: 4649 Sunnyside Ave N Seattle, Washington, US + (+1 more)
Company Size: 1 - 100
Industry: Individual and Family Services